The Good
- Variety of Games: Online casinos typically offer various roulette variants, including European, American, and French roulette. Each version has its own rules and house edge, with European roulette featuring a lower house edge of about 2.7%.
- Flexible Betting Options: Players can place bets as low as £0.10 on many platforms, making it accessible for all budgets. High rollers can also find tables with maximum bets reaching up to £10,000.
- Convenience: The ability to play from home or on the go via mobile devices is a significant advantage, allowing for a more relaxed gaming atmosphere.
- Bonuses and Promotions: Many online casinos offer enticing welcome bonuses and promotions, such as free spins or deposit matches, which can enhance your bankroll significantly.
The Bad
- Higher House Edge in Some Variants: While European roulette has a lower house edge, American roulette features an additional double zero, increasing the house edge to around 5.26%.
- Potential for Addiction: The ease of access can lead to problem gambling. It is essential to set limits and gamble responsibly.
- Withdrawal Times: Although deposits are usually instant, withdrawals can take several days to process, depending on the payment method chosen.
The Ugly
- Regulatory Issues: Not all online casinos are licensed, which can expose players to unregulated environments. The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) ensures that players in the UK are protected, but it’s crucial to verify a casino’s licence status before playing.
- Wagering Requirements: Bonuses often come with high wagering requirements, typically around 35x, making it difficult to cash out winnings.
- Software Reliability: The technology behind online roulette, including Random Number Generators (RNGs), can vary between providers. Some players may question the fairness of certain platforms.
Comparison of Roulette Variants
| Variant | House Edge | Min Bet | Max Bet |
|---|---|---|---|
| European Roulette | 2.7% | £0.10 | £10,000 |
| American Roulette | 5.26% | £0.10 | £10,000 |
| French Roulette | 1.35% (with La Partage) | £0.10 | £10,000 |
